How a VA Loan Is Handled When You Sell
When you sell a home bought with a VA loan, the loan is paid off from the sale proceeds at closing, just like any other mortgage. Once the loan is paid in full, your VA entitlement is generally restored — freeing it for your next duty-station purchase. The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s explains entitlement and restoration in detail. A cash sale handles the VA payoff at settlement with no extra steps for you.
Why the Timeline Matters for VA Sellers
If you are PCSing on a report date, the entitlement question is also a timing question: the sooner the loan is paid off, the sooner your entitlement is available for the home at your next station.
